		<description>This utility simply automaticly renames the EXE file of a game to &quot;crysis&quot; for &quot;Direct3D Mode&quot; or &quot;etqw&quot; for &quot;OpenGL Mode&quot;. This could cause rendering errors, but it may be worth a try.</description>
